The new Sportage is due to be unveiled in July in Korea. The new Sportage has been specifically designed to leave a new mark on this version – for its enhanced exterior and interior design, tech, and highly efficient powertrains. In September, for the first time in the model’s 28-year history, the Kia Sportage will have a customized European version.
It was revealed earlier this year, Kia’s new design language – Opposites United- is the centre of the New Sportage therefore dominating every part of its appearance and character. The early images suggest a bold and cutting-edge vibe for the SUV.
The new Sportage
The outstanding details of the new Sportage include the crisp lines that ripple across the surfaces. A detailed black grille runs across the width of the face. At the rear, muscular shoulder lines drop gently to meet slim daytime-running lamps, which flank the new Kia logo and Sportage emblem.
